Dishwasher - Plastic Smell
Most odors associated with new appliances are normal. The processes used during manufacturing may often leave a "newness" odor that may not dissipate until after several washing cycles. You can help alleviate this condition by running the dishwasher through several cycles using detergent.
Eliminating the Plastic Smell From Inside a Dishwasher
- This is normal and the smell dissipates during normal use.
- During initial use you may smell the tub material, chlorine bleach in detergent, or the smell of rinse aid.
- You can also try running the empty dishwasher through several cycles using detergent.
